Verdict
A lens this good deserves a wider audience than it will probably get. One way to do that would be for Nikon to supply its 24mm f/1.4 in other mounts but that is very unlikely. More likely, and more beneficial to Nikon, is the fact that this lens is clearly part of a major Nikkor advantage in optical design that might tempt other users to look afresh at the Nikon system.
